Output 77dcc879ed85fe15d57733bdc95d4627d84b3ba2f68a62e2cccbdd6bfce55234:0

value
2606815860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ef976b9424eb2cd90ea621d260d6b5396abfb4b2 OP_EQUAL
address
3PXrpFe19tyarWq5qrKjYCV3e8Stk8j1ad
transaction
77dcc879ed85fe15d57733bdc95d4627d84b3ba2f68a62e2cccbdd6bfce55234
spent
true